Irregularity in Waste Composition



In the realm of commercial wastewater treatment, the variability in waste make-up provides a this content powerful challenge. Industries create wastewater with diverse qualities, affected by aspects such as production procedures, raw products, and operational techniques. This diversification complicates the therapy process, as conventional systems usually have a hard time to efficiently resolve the wide variety of toxins present.


For instance, wastewater from food handling may consist of high levels of natural matter, while effluents from chemical production could consist of dangerous materials and heavy steels. This variance demands adaptable therapy approaches to make certain compliance with ecological regulations and secure public health. Furthermore, variations in waste composition can take place over time, affected by adjustments in production routines, upkeep activities, or the intro of new items.

Cutting-edge Treatment Solutions



Ingenious therapy services are crucial for dealing with the intricacies of industrial wastewater administration. Typical methods commonly fall short in successfully removing a variety of contaminants, especially in centers with varied effluent streams. Recent developments concentrate on incorporating cutting-edge innovations to improve therapy efficiency and sustainability.


One promising technique is using innovative oxidation processes (AOPs), which leverage powerful oxidants to break down natural toxins. AOPs, consisting of photocatalysis and ozonation, can considerably decrease hazardous materials and boost effluent top quality. Additionally, membrane bioreactor (MBR) technology has acquired traction, integrating biological treatment with membrane filtering, leading to top notch effluent and minimized impact.


An additional cutting-edge remedy is the execution of source recuperation systems. Strategies like anaerobic food digestion not just deal with wastewater however likewise produce biogas, which Visit Website can be utilized as a renewable energy resource. The adoption of artificial intelligence and machine knowing models can optimize treatment procedures by anticipating variants in wastewater structure, thereby boosting functional effectiveness.


These innovative solutions not just address regulative compliance yet likewise promote ecological sustainability, leading the way for an extra effective and resilient commercial community.
